Linguistic Origin and Root Meaning

The name 'Jaycub' is a modern variant of the traditional name 'Jacob', which originates from the Hebrew name יַעֲקֹב (Ya'aqov). The Hebrew root can be traced back to the root עקב (`aqab), meaning "to follow", "to be behind" but also "to supplant", "circumvent", "assail", and "overreach". This dual meaning is reflected in the biblical narrative of Jacob, who was born holding his twin brother Esau's heel and later supplanted him to gain his father's blessing. Over centuries, the name Jacob has undergone various transformations in different languages, including 'Iacobus' in Latin, 'Iakov' in Greek, and 'James' in English. 'Jaycub' represents a contemporary phonetic spelling that maintains the original name's auditory essence while modernizing its presentation.

Cultural and Historical Usage

Historically, the name Jacob has been widely used across Jewish, Christian, and Islamic cultures due to its significant biblical connections. In Christianity, Jacob is revered as the father of the twelve tribes of Israel, making the name common among Christians. Similarly, in Jewish communities, Jacob is considered one of the patriarchs, and his name is prevalent. In Islamic tradition, Jacob (known as Ya'qub) is recognized as a prophet. The variant 'Jaycub' has emerged in modern times, particularly in English-speaking countries, serving as a distinctive take on a traditional name, thus preserving its cultural reverence while appealing to contemporary naming trends.

Symbolic or Spiritual Significance

In spiritual and religious contexts, the name Jacob—and by extension, its variant 'Jaycub'—is laden with significant symbolism. Jacob's life, characterized by struggle and eventual triumph, is often seen as a symbol of persistence, faith, and divine favor. His visionary experience of a ladder reaching to heaven is interpreted in many religious traditions as a symbol of the connection between the divine and the earthly. In the esoteric and mystical traditions, Jacob's wrestle with the angel and his subsequent renaming to Israel are seen as metaphors for spiritual struggle and transformation.

Famous Historical or Mythical Figures

While the name 'Jaycub' itself does not have historical or mythical figures bearing it, its original form, Jacob, is richly represented. Jacob, the biblical patriarch, is perhaps the most famous figure associated with this name. His narrative in the Book of Genesis has been influential in various religious and cultural contexts. Another historical figure is Jacob of Serugh, a renowned sixth-century Syriac Christian poet and theologian, known for his liturgical poetry.
